The Role 
Maths Teacher - Salary: Teachers Main Scale - UPS Pay Range (£25,714- £41,604) 
 
Location: Dormston School, Mill Bank, Sedgley, DY3 1SN 
 
Required for September 2021 or January 2022, we are looking for a highly motivated, creative and inspiring Teacher of Maths to join our highly successful and well-resourced Maths Department. 
 
The Mathematics department is a supportive, progressive and successful department.  It currently comprises of 10 members of teaching staff (including a small group intervention teacher) and also a HLTA.  The whole department is located in one area of our school and each team member has their own classroom. We are a hardworking and dedicated team of professionals who enjoy Mathematics and share that passion in the classroom.
